#70fad5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#70fad5 is composed of 43.9% red, 98% green and 83.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 14.8%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 163.9 degrees, a saturation of 93.2% and a lightness of 71%. #70fad5 color hex could be obtained by blending #e0ffff with #00f5ab. Closest websafe color is: #66ffcc.

#70fad5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#70fad5 has RGB values of R:112, G:250, B:213 and CMYK values of C:0.55, M:0, Y:0.15,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 7404245.

Shades and Tints of #70fad5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000906 is the darkest color, while #f5fffc is the lightest one.

Tones of #70fad5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b4b6b5 is the less saturated color, while #70fad5 is the most saturated one.
